[Success] Gigabyte Z690 ELITE AX - OpenCore 0.7.6 Build Hackintosh

《[Success] Gigabyte Z690 ELITE AX - OpenCore 0.7.6 Build Hackintosh》
Gigabyte Z690 ELITE AX

前言

這台12th黑果,是社團成員Shuwen Chiang 於11/17日購買的。這是我第一次著手進行Intel最新的 12th PC零組件,嘗試安裝病是否能夠運行macOS。本引導採用OC0.7.6版本,以及使用CaseySJ所提供的修補文件,重新編譯而成。經過一夜的努力,總算是成功安裝黑蘋果了。

本教程是依據我構建GA Z490 ELITE(AC)、Z590 ELITE AX 的經驗,嘗試針對技嘉 Z690 ELITE 主板進行OC引導文件的編輯。該引導文件的設定,以及 UEFI 的參數配置,將會一一的記錄下來。

使用的設備

  • CPU I9-12900k
  • MB GA-z690 AORUS ELITE AX DDR4
  • RAM 32GBx16G 3200mhz DDR4
  • SSD 980 PRO 1 TB PCIe 4.0 NVMe M.2
  • 水冷 MSI MAG Coreliquid c240
  • Power 1600w

UEFI 設置如下:

如果有新的韌體,你可以從官網中下載來更新UEFI,截至本教程發布日期,目版本為F4。

開機並按DELF2進入BIOS 設置。為了要安裝macOS,請按照下面的配置所列出的韌體參數來設置。一開始從 Save & Exit –> Load Optimized Defaults ,這是原廠預先所預設最佳的參數值,再來我們在這些參數之上進一步的更改。

  • 如有必要,按F2切換到 Advanced Mode
  • F7保存並退出→ 加載優化的默認值(按 F7 一鍵加載優化的默認值)
  • Tweaker
    • Extreme Memory Profile(X.M.P) → Profile1
    • System Memory Multiplier → Auto (default)
  • Settings → IOPorts
    • Internal Graphics → Enabled (not Auto)帶有F的CPU,這裡無需設定
    • HD Audio Controller → Enabled (default)
    • Above 4G Decoding → Enabled
    • Re-Size BAR Support → Enabled (如果你的 GPU 支持)或者它可以被禁用
  • Settings → IOPorts → Thunderbolt Configuration (如果安裝了 Thunderbolt 擴展卡,否則這裡不需要設定)
    • PCIE Tunneling over USB4 → Enabled (default)
    • Discrete Thunderbolt Support → Enabled (default)
    • Wake from Thunderbolt Devices → Enabled (default)
  • Settings → IOPorts → Thunderbolt Configuration → Discrete Thunderbolt Configuration
    • Thunderbolt Boot Support → Enabled (default)
    • GPIO3 Force Per → Enabled (default)
    • GPIO Filter → Disabled (default)
    • DTBT Go2Sx Command → Enabled (default)
  • Settings → IOPorts → Super IO Configuration
    • Serial Port → Disabled
  • Settings → IOPorts → USB Configuration
    • XHCI Hand-off → Enabled (defualt)
  • Settings → IOPorts → SATA Configuration
    • SATA Mode → AHCI (default)
  • Settings → Miscellaneous
    • Intel Platform Trust Technology → Enabled (default)
    • VT-d → Enabled (default)
  • Boot
    • CFG-Lock → Disabled (default)
    • Fast Boot → Disabled (default)
    • Windows 10 Features → Windows 10 (default)
    • CSM Support → Disabled (default)
  • Tweaker –> Advanced CPU Settings
    CPU Cores Enabling Mode –> Selectable Mode
    CPU Cores Enabling Mode –> Enable P-cores and/or E-cores,–> 根據選項 1選項 2設置為啟用禁用
    Hyper-Threading Technology 這部分禁用
  • Save & Exit → Save Profiles
    • 到這裡,UEFI 設定算是完成。
    • 重新開機後,按下F12 選擇U盤引導開機。

音效部分:

  • 內建Realtek® ALC1220-VB 晶片,得加入AooleALC.kext,並注入ID為 1

使用獨顯

用戶如果使用 Navi GPU之類的顯示卡,請在 boot-args 中填入agdpmod=pikera。

製作USB引導碟

需要的文件

由於第 12 代 Alder Lake 為最新產品,同時我採用DDR4 的內存,採用 Opencore 0.7.6 的測試版(因為 Opencore 開發團隊正在為 Alder Lake 提供支持。),VirtualSMC 和 Opencore 的各個部分目前正在重寫,

所以,在ACPI 使用的SSDT 修正檔,依序排列使用 

  • SSDT-CPUR-Z690.aml 
  • SSDT-AWAC.aml
  • SSDT-EC.aml
  • SSDT-PLUG.aml 最低限度。

Opencore 引導配置

ACPI 所需要的SSDT修護檔

《[Success] Gigabyte Z690 ELITE AX - OpenCore 0.7.6 Build Hackintosh》
ACPI

新增這個補丁 ACPI patch:MC__ to MCHC patch

  • Signature: DSDT
  • Find: 4D 43 5F 5F
  • Replace: 4D 43 48 43
  • Comment: Change MC__ to MCHC
  • Enabled: Click on
《[Success] Gigabyte Z690 ELITE AX - OpenCore 0.7.6 Build Hackintosh》
ACPI patch

怪避

《[Success] Gigabyte Z690 ELITE AX - OpenCore 0.7.6 Build Hackintosh》

設備PCI通道,如果主板內建的 Intel i225-V 網卡,device-id 設定為F3158680,方能完美驅動,無需再加載PCIID。

《[Success] Gigabyte Z690 ELITE AX - OpenCore 0.7.6 Build Hackintosh》

Kext 加載:XhcPortLimet 不勾選

《[Success] Gigabyte Z690 ELITE AX - OpenCore 0.7.6 Build Hackintosh》

CPUID1Data 應該是:

代碼:

55060A00 00000000 00000000 00000000

你的 CPUID1Mask 應該是:
代碼:

FFFFFFFF 00000000 00000000 00000000

最小內核:20.0
AppleXcpmCfgLock:已啟用,並在 BIOS 中關閉超線程。

加載USB補丁

《[Success] Gigabyte Z690 ELITE AX - OpenCore 0.7.6 Build Hackintosh》

MISE

《[Success] Gigabyte Z690 ELITE AX - OpenCore 0.7.6 Build Hackintosh》

.

《[Success] Gigabyte Z690 ELITE AX - OpenCore 0.7.6 Build Hackintosh》

.

-v keepsyms=1 debug=0x100 -wegnoigpu #agdpmod=pikera

《[Success] Gigabyte Z690 ELITE AX - OpenCore 0.7.6 Build Hackintosh》

機型

《[Success] Gigabyte Z690 ELITE AX - OpenCore 0.7.6 Build Hackintosh》

UEFI

《[Success] Gigabyte Z690 ELITE AX - OpenCore 0.7.6 Build Hackintosh》

.

《[Success] Gigabyte Z690 ELITE AX - OpenCore 0.7.6 Build Hackintosh》

可調整大小的 GPU BAR(基地址寄存器):
一些最新的 AMD GPU 支持可調整大小的基地址寄存器 (BAR)。此功能可增強 Windows 中的 GPU 性能,但不會增強 macOS 中的 GPU 性能。幸運的是,可以在 BIOS 中啟用 Resizable BAR Support,而不會影響 macOS,但為了確保 macOS 中的睡眠/喚醒行為正常,我們推薦以下設置:

  • config.plist –> Booter –> ResizeAppleGpuBars –> 0 (默認 = -1)
  • config.plist –> UEFI –> ResizeGpuBars –> -1 (默認 = -1)
《[Success] Gigabyte Z690 ELITE AX - OpenCore 0.7.6 Build Hackintosh》

未完!

点赞
Share